The moment the public vital has been configured over the server, the server will allow any connecting person which has the non-public critical to log in. During the login approach, the consumer proves possession with the non-public critical by digitally signing the key exchange.
Open up your ~/.ssh/config file, then modify the file to incorporate the following traces. Should your SSH key file has a unique title or route than the example code, modify the filename or route to match your latest setup.
In the next action, you'll open up a terminal on your Computer system to be able to entry the SSH utility used to make a set of SSH keys.
Mainly because the whole process of relationship would require entry to your personal essential, and since you safeguarded your SSH keys driving a passphrase, You will need to supply your passphrase so the connection can move forward.
Though passwords are sent for the server in a very safe way, They are really frequently not complex or long sufficient for being resistant to repeated, persistent attackers.
If you choose to overwrite The true secret on disk, you won't have the capacity to authenticate utilizing the former key anymore. Choosing “Sure” is undoubtedly an irreversible harmful course of action.
On the other hand, OpenSSH certificates can be extremely handy for server authentication and will reach identical benefits as the standard X.509 certificates. Nevertheless, they require their particular infrastructure for certificate issuance.
The SSH protocol makes use of community critical cryptography for authenticating hosts and users. The authentication keys, referred to as SSH keys, are made using the keygen system.
ed25519 - this is the new algorithm additional in OpenSSH. Aid for it in consumers isn't still common. Thus its use usually objective apps may well not but be sensible.
Some familiarity with dealing with a terminal plus the command line. If you want an introduction createssh to dealing with terminals along with the command line, you may stop by our guideline A Linux Command Line Primer.
When a consumer requests to connect to a server with SSH, the server sends a message encrypted with the general public critical which can only be decrypted with the connected private vital. The person’s regional device then utilizes its personal crucial to make an effort to decrypt the concept.
Note: The public critical is recognized with the .pub extension. You should utilize Notepad to begin to see the contents of the two the non-public and general public important.
Handling SSH keys can become cumbersome once you have to make use of a 2nd key. Typically, you would use ssh-incorporate to retail store your keys to ssh-agent, typing from the password for every key.
OpenSSH has its personal proprietary certification format, which may be used for signing host certificates or consumer certificates. For user authentication, The shortage of highly safe certification authorities combined with The shortcoming to audit who will accessibility a server by inspecting the server will make us advocate against employing OpenSSH certificates for person authentication.